Description
Model Type:ControlLogix Processor
Manufacturer:Allen-Bradley
Processor Type:Logix5565
Power Dissipation:12 Watts
User Memory:4 MB
Maximum I/O:128,000 Points
Analog I/O:4,000 Channels
Digital I/O:128,000 Channels
Communication Interfaces:ControlNet, Ethernet, DeviceNet
Operating Temperature Range:-40°C to +70°C
Enclosure Type:IP20 Open Type
Power Supply Voltage:85 to 264 Vac, 85 to 264 Vdc
Certifications:UL, CE, cUL, TUV
